Fretboard Templates

Posted on December 30, 2012 at 10:55am 5 Comments

Here is a zip file that contains a handful of commonly used fretboard scales. Simply print out the PDF, cut it out with scissors and tape it together so the lines match. Then tape it to your fretboard and mark the fret locations. Enjoy!
